Why is there a shortage of El Pato sauce?

Walker Foods Inc., a Los Angeles-based food firm, has discontinued the sale of a Mexican-made spicy sauce after a research indicated that it had levels of lead that above FDA guidelines, according to the company’s president and CEO. “As a result of the investigation, we’ve suspended sales and purchases of [El Pato Salsa Picante] as of two days ago,” Robert Walker stated.

How many Scoville units is Frank’s Red Hot?

Frank’s Red Hot Chili Peppers This hot sauce is produced from cayenne peppers and contains 450 Scoville Heat Units (SHU). As reported by Frank’s Restaurants in Buffalo, New York, in 1964, the sauce was the secret ingredient in the original Buffalo wings recipe, which was produced in Buffalo, New York.

How hot is a scorpion chilli?

Recently, the Trinidad Moruga Scorpion was dubbed “the new world’s hottest chili pepper,” with some specimens of this pungent plant recording more than 2 million Scoville heat units, according to a recent research (SHU). That implies that each of these small bundles of delight contains the heat of almost 400 jalapenos.

What Scoville is da bomb?

Da’Bomb is available in four different degrees of pain: Ghost Pepper, which has 22,800 Scovilles, Beyond Insanity, which has 135,600 Scovilles, Ground Zero, which has 321,900 Scovilles, and The Final Answer, which has 1.5 million! They’re absolutely explosive!

How hot is Taco Bell Fire Sauce Scoville?

Fire Sauce, which was introduced by Taco Bell in the early 2000s, is not significantly different in terms of its ingredients from many other hot sauces available on the market. Scoville heat rating: 500, making it hotter than Louisiana Fiery Sauce (450 SHU), but less hot than Cholula (1,000 SHU).

What is El Pato sauce used for?

It is created with fresh chiles, tomatoes, onions, garlic, and spices, and is known as El Pato Hot Tomato Sauce Mexican Style. This sauce is perfect for enchiladas, tacos, chilaquiles, and any other meat or fish meal you can think of. All of your favorite south-of-the-border recipes that call for tomato sauce will benefit from the addition of this spicy seasoning.
